# Firesoft Project
## Overview
EMS/Fire department incident management software built with Expo React Native.
**Status:** In Progress
**Workspace:** `/home/mike/code/Firesoft`
**Project ID:** `bf1cbed2-9943-49e0-bf64-6e2f132b8790`
**Repository:** https://git.freno.me/Mike/Firesoft.git
## Tech Stack
- **Framework:** Expo (React Native 0.81.5, React 19.1.0, Expo SDK 54)
- **Language:** TypeScript
- **Database:** Turso (libsql) with local-first architecture
- **State Management:** MobX
- **Authentication:** Clerk
- **Navigation:** Expo Router (file-based routing)
- **Theming:** Light/dark mode support
## Architecture
### Key Directories
- `app/` - File-based routing (Expo Router)
- `(auth)/` - Authentication screens
- `(tabs)/` - Main tab navigation
- `components/` - Reusable UI components
- `ui/` - Basic UI components
- `layouts/` - Screen layout wrappers
- `services/` - Business logic and API calls
- `hooks/` - Custom React hooks
- `stores/` - MobX stores
- `database/` - Turso database utilities
- `types/` - TypeScript type definitions
### Data Layer
- **Local-first:** Works offline with sync queue
- **Services:** IncidentService, ProfileService, etc.
- **Custom Hooks:** useIncidents, useTrainingRecords, useDepartments, useUsers
